Dominion Energy sells 25 percent stake in Cove Point

U.S. LNG operator Dominion Energy has entered into an agreement with Brookfield Super-Core Infrastructure Partners to sell a 25 percent non-controlling equity interest in Cove Point to Brookfield for just over $2 billion.

FERC grants permit for Cameron LNG Train 2 commissioning start

The United States Federal Energy Regulatory Commission (FERC) granted Sempra Energy to start the commissioning process of the second liquefaction train at the Cameron LNG plant in Hackberry, Louisiana.

GATE LNG terminal’s nine-month throughput rises

Liquefied natural gas (LNG) throughput volumes at the Dutch Gate terminal have gone up in the first nine months of the year as European consumption of gas produced in the Atlantic region jumped.

Mubadala makes $50 mln buy in NextDecade

US LNG export project developer NextDecade Corporation and Mubadala Investment Company, have reached an agreement for Mubadala to purchase $50 million of NextDecade’s common stock in a private placement.

Golar Power wins Brazilian LNG-to-power project deal

Golar LNG said that Golar Power, a (50/50) joint venture with Stonepeak Infrastructure Partners, has been awarded a 25-year power purchase agreement (PPA) for the construction of a 605MW combined cycle thermal power plant in Brazil.
